Cornelia K. Henry

Cornelia Kivlighan Henry, 84, loved mother and grandmother, passed peacefully to her heavenly home on March 28, 2022. She was born October 30, 1937, the daughter of the late Mary Abbitt and Joseph Harold Kivlighan.

Cornelia was a graduate of Holton-Arms Junior College in Washington DC and the University of Virginia School of Nursing. She was active in her nursing career for thirty-five years. She proudly served five years as a Navy nurse, spending a year in Vietnam from 1968-1969 at the NSA Hospital near DaNang.

Cornelia was an active member of First Presbyterian Church for many years where she served as an elder, head usher, trustee, and in various other areas. She was a devoted 25-year volunteer for Augusta Health, Meals on Wheels, Trinity Noon Lunch Program, American Red Cross, and the YMCA.
